A robust, async-based Python API designed to interface seamlessly with the Rithmic Protocol Buffer API. This package is built to provide an efficient and reliable connection to Rithmic's trading infrastructure, catering to advanced trading strategies and real-time data handling.
This was originally a fork of pyrithmic, but the code has been completely rewritten.
This repo introduces several key improvements and new features over the original repository, ensuring compatibility with modern Python environments and providing additional functionality:
- Python 3.11+ Compatibility: Fully tested and supported on the latest Python versions.
- Robust architecture: Engineered for concurrency with built-in automatic reconnection logic. Ideal for long-running, fault-tolerant applications.
- Multi-account support: select which account to operate on, removing the limitation of a fixed primary account.
- STOP Orders support: includes the ability to place and manage STOP orders.
- Best Bid Offer (BBO) Streaming: Integrates real-time Best Bid Offer tick streaming.
- Historical + Streaming Time Bars: Access both historical time bars and real-time bar streaming for time-based strategies.
The most significant architectural shift is the adoption of an async-first design, delivering improved responsiveness, efficient I/O handling, and better scalability for real-time trading and market data ingestion.
